- Disambiguation notice
- 1) Alexander Campbell (1788-1866), details above , author of The Christian System and Millennial Harbinger, leader of the Stone-Campbell Movement on the American frontier from which the Christian Church (Disciples of Christ), Churches of Christ, and Christian Churches and Churches of Christ descend.
2) Campbell, Alexander 1912-1977 - , a native of Scotland, wrote The Heart of Japan and spent time as the managing editor of the New Republic.
3) Alexander Campbell, author of Christian curricula for children for Educational Ministries such as Stories of Jesus, stories of now
5) Alexander Campbell (1764-1824), also known as Timothy Twig, esquire, author of Sangs of the Lowlands of Scotland, carefully compared with the original editions, and embellished with characteristic designs
6) Alexander Campbell (b. 7-10-25), author of The covenant story of the Bible
7) Alexander Campbell (March 9, 1822 – 24 May 1892), author of General Instructions For The Guidance Of Post Office Inspectors In The Dominion Of Canada
8) Alexander Campbell, fl. 2000 - Handbook of Poisoning in Dogs and Cats
